/*---------------------------------------------------
	Hauptnavigation
---------------------------------------------------*/

div#navigation ul {
	margin: 0; 
	padding: 0 0 0 28px;
}

div#navigation li {
	list-style: none; 
	margin: 0;
	padding: 0 0 8px 0;
	background-color: none;
	text-transform:uppercase;	
}

div#navigation li a {
	font: 12px/15px Arial, Helvetica, sans-serif;
	color: #fff;
	font-weight: bold;
	display: inline; 
	text-decoration: none;
	margin: 0;
	padding: 0;
	/* IE < 6 Hack */
	width: 100%;
	voice-family: "\"}\"";
	voice-family: inherit;
	/* Ende IE < 6 Hack */	
}

div#navigation li a.act, div#navigation li a:hover{
	color: #fff200;
	margin: 0;
	padding: 0;
	/* IE < 6 Hack */
	width: 100%;
	voice-family: "\"}\"";
	voice-family: inherit;
	/* Ende IE < 6 Hack */
}

/*--------------------------------------------------*/
/*SubNavigation*/
/*--------------------------------------------------*/

div#navigation ul.sub{
	width: 195px;
	padding: 6px 0 8px 12px;
	margin: 3px 0 2px 0;
	background-color: #1a66af;	
}


div#navigation ul.sub li {
	list-style: none; 
	margin: 0;
	padding: 0;
	text-transform: none;
}

div#navigation ul.sub li a {
	font: 12px/20px Arial, Helvetica, sans-serif;
	font-weight: normal; 
	color: #ffffff;
	display: inline; 
	text-decoration: none;
	margin: 0;
	padding: 0 0 4px 0;
	/* IE < 6 Hack */
	width: 100%;
	voice-family: "\"}\"";
	voice-family: inherit;
	/* Ende IE < 6 Hack */
}

div#navigation ul.sub li a.act, div#navigation ul.sub li a:hover{
	color: #fff200;
	font-weight: normal;
	padding: 0;
}

/* level 3 */
div#navigation ul.sub ul {width: 183px;padding: 2px 0 8px 12px; margin: 0;}


/*---------------------------------------------------
	Ort Navigation
---------------------------------------------------*/

div#navigation ul.ort {
	clear: right;
	float: left;
	margin: 25px 0 0 0;
	padding: 0 0 0 28px;
	width: 213px;
}

div#navigation ul.ort li{
	list-style: none; 
	margin: 0;
	padding: 0;
	background-color: none;
	text-transform:uppercase;
}

div#navigation ul.ort li a{
	font: 12px/25px Arial, Helvetica, sans-serif; 
	color: #fff;
	font-weight: normal;
	display: inline; 
	text-decoration: none;
	margin: 0;
	padding: 0;
	/* IE < 6 Hack */
	width: 100%;
	voice-family: "\"}\"";
	voice-family: inherit;
	/* Ende IE < 6 Hack */
}

div#navigation ul.ort li a:hover{
	color: #fff200;
}

div#navigation ul.ort li a.act, div#navigation ul.ort li a:hover{
	color: #fff200;
	font-weight: normal;
	padding: 0;
}

